Σπίτι Cloud-Computing Τι είναι η εικονικοποίηση εφαρμογών; - ορισμός από την τεχνολογία

Τι είναι η εικονικοποίηση εφαρμογών; - ορισμός από την τεχνολογία

Πίνακας περιεχομένων:

Anonim

Ορισμός - Τι σημαίνει Εικονικοποίηση εφαρμογών;

Η εικονικοποίηση εφαρμογών, που ονομάζεται επίσης εφαρμογή virtualization υπηρεσίας εφαρμογών, είναι ένας όρος κάτω από τη μεγαλύτερη ομπρέλα του virtualization. Αναφέρεται στην εκτέλεση μιας εφαρμογής σε ένα λεπτό πελάτη. ένα τερματικό ή ένα σταθμό εργασίας δικτύου με λίγα κατοικημένα προγράμματα και πρόσβαση στα περισσότερα προγράμματα που διαμένουν σε έναν συνδεδεμένο διακομιστή. Ο λεπτός πελάτης εκτελείται σε περιβάλλον διαφορετικό από το λειτουργικό σύστημα όπου βρίσκεται η εφαρμογή.

Η εικονικοποίηση εφαρμογών εξοργίζει τον υπολογιστή να λειτουργεί όπως εάν η εφαρμογή εκτελείται στο τοπικό μηχάνημα, ενώ στην πραγματικότητα εκτελείται σε μια εικονική μηχανή (όπως ένας διακομιστής) σε άλλη τοποθεσία, χρησιμοποιώντας το λειτουργικό της σύστημα (OS) και προσπελαζόμενο από το τοπικό μηχάνημα. Τα προβλήματα ασυμβατότητας με το λειτουργικό σύστημα του τοπικού υπολογιστή, ή ακόμα και σφάλματα ή κώδικας κακής ποιότητας στην εφαρμογή, μπορεί να ξεπεραστούν με την εκτέλεση εικονικών εφαρμογών.

Η Techopedia εξηγεί την Εικονικοποίηση εφαρμογών

Η εφαρμογή εικονικοποίησης προσπαθεί να διαχωρίσει τα προγράμματα εφαρμογών από ένα λειτουργικό σύστημα με το οποίο έχει συγκρούσεις, ακόμη και να αναγκάσει τα συστήματα να σταματήσουν ή να συντρίψουν. Άλλα πλεονεκτήματα για την εικονικοποίηση εφαρμογών περιλαμβάνουν:

  • Απαιτεί λιγότερους πόρους σε σύγκριση με τη χρήση ξεχωριστής εικονικής μηχανής.
  • Επιτρέποντας ταυτόχρονα την εκτέλεση ασύμβατων εφαρμογών σε τοπικό μηχάνημα.
  • Διατηρώντας μια τυπική, αποδοτικότερη και αποδοτικότερη διαμόρφωση λειτουργικού συστήματος σε πολλαπλά μηχανήματα σε έναν συγκεκριμένο οργανισμό, ανεξάρτητα από τις εφαρμογές που χρησιμοποιούνται.
  • Διευκόλυνση της ταχύτερης ανάπτυξης εφαρμογών.
  • Διευκόλυνση της ασφάλειας με την απομόνωση εφαρμογών από το τοπικό λειτουργικό σύστημα.
  • Ευκολότερη παρακολούθηση της χρήσης της άδειας χρήσης, η οποία μπορεί να εξοικονομηθεί με το κόστος της άδειας.
  • Επιτρέποντας την αντιγραφή εφαρμογών σε φορητά μέσα και τη χρήση άλλων υπολογιστών-πελατών χωρίς την ανάγκη τοπικής εγκατάστασης.
  • Αύξηση της ικανότητας χειρισμού του υψηλού και ποικίλου / μεταβλητού όγκου εργασίας.

Ωστόσο, υπάρχουν περιορισμοί στην εικονικοποίηση εφαρμογών. Δεν είναι δυνατή η virtualization όλων των εφαρμογών, όπως εφαρμογές που απαιτούν προγράμματα οδήγησης συσκευών και εφαρμογές 16 bit που εκτελούνται σε κοινόχρηστη μνήμη. Ορισμένες εφαρμογές πρέπει να ενσωματωθούν στενά στο τοπικό λειτουργικό σύστημα, όπως τα προγράμματα προστασίας από ιούς, καθώς είναι πολύ δύσκολο να εκτελεστούν με την εικονικοποίηση εφαρμογών.


Η εικονικοποίηση εφαρμογών χρησιμοποιείται σε μια ευρεία ποικιλία εφαρμογών, όπως τραπεζικές εργασίες, προσομοιώσεις επιχειρηματικών σεναρίων, ηλεκτρονικό εμπόριο, εμπορία μετοχών και πωλήσεις και εμπορία ασφαλιστικών προϊόντων.

Τι είναι η εικονικοποίηση εφαρμογών; - ορισμός από την τεχνολογία